The Museum of Black Civilisations is a landmark institution in Dakar dedicated to celebrating and preserving the heritage of African peoples worldwide. Housed in a dramatic circular building inspired by traditional architecture, the museum offers a journey through centuries of art, history, and cultural achievements. Visitors explore galleries filled with artifacts, contemporary artworks, and interactive displays that challenge colonial narratives and highlight Africa's contributions to humanity. The museum's distinctive design and thought-provoking exhibits make it a must-visit for understanding the continent's rich and diverse legacy.
